Hi,

I want to expand my recording setup. I'm looking for something with 8 mic pres.

I will be using a mac primarily but Windows support would be cool too.

I'm hesitant to buy the US-16X08 after the pain I have every time I upgrade my operating system with my US-600.

Have things improved with the newer interfaces?

Browsing around this forum I see a lot of people having problems with the 16x08. Have these largely been resolved?

Basically, if I buy it am I likely to regret it? Should I buy the US-16x08 or should I spend the extra cash on a Focusrite?

After MUCH researching and going back and forth, I'm happy with mine. All the problems and negative amazon reviews that I could find involved Windows. It’s a good I/O if you just wanna plug in and record multiple mics/lines. I’ve been fairly happy with mine so far connected to my macbook air. No humming, buzzing, or any audio problems of any kind. Sounds crystal clear and works great. I was fairly surprised that you don’t even have to download drivers if you use it on a mac. You just plug it in and it works great. The only thing I’m not a fan of is that it doesn’t have any separate busses. It really limits it’s mixing options as far as I can tell. Since I use garageband I can’t configure the outputs at all, so while I can get a lot of separate lines going in, I effectively only get 4 stereo pairs of the exact same main mix as output, with no ability to create separate monitor mixes. Its effectively a US 16x02. Kinda lame. For my situation I guess I need to decide to either upgrade to Logic or get the Tascam US 20x20 which has a few separate busses so that I can configure the output. (If I’m wrong on this by all means make my day by correcting me).

As an incredibally cheap Input with a ton of mic-pres, line in’s, and even 2 instrument ins, I highly recommend it. What else can you get this much input from for $300?
